Over a long period of time in a large multinational corporation, 10% of all sales trainees are rated as outstanding, 75% are rate excellent/good, 10% are rated satisfactory, and 5% are considered unsatisfactory. Find the following probabilities for a sample of n = 10 trainees selected at random:

(a) Two or more are rated as outstanding. (b) None of the trainees are rated as unsatisfactory.

(c) Two are rated outstanding, six are rated excellent/good, one is rated satisfactory, and one is rated unsatisfactory.
